Revenue Service
Inaccurate records and bad accounting procedures must be ended.
Stilted, inflexible, arrogant auditors and other staff must be replaced with a better calibre of person. The attitude that SARS is always right, is wrong, and must be severely dealt with among SARS staff interacting with the public.
Better communication between SARS staff is needed to ensure that the necessary role-players know what is going on and in order to be able to get things up to date.
Certain departments will be removed / phased out as a result of legislation, such as capital gains tax.
SARS will be leaned up into a highly professional, respectful and competent workforce, not policing the public but serving, guiding and advising them.
